1. Local Exhaust Ventilation and Air Pollution Control System (Rhode Island)

M&A designed a Local Exhaust Ventilation System consisting of hoods, ductwork, integral exhaust fan, and a wet scrubber for a manufacturer of a variety of decorative ornaments and other specialty photochemically machined parts. The manufacturer reduced its emissions of HAPs by 95%, with the new system, and so avoided regulation of the facility as a Major Source and eliminated the need for a Title V permit.

2. LEV/APC Design (Massachusetts)

For a manufacturer of various products including art gum erasers, lampshade cleaning puffs, wallpaper cleaning pads, and a vibration reducing additive for concrete, M&A designed a LEV system with a scrubber system to control S2Cl2 emissions. The scrubber system has an overall removal efficiency of 96-98& of S2Cl2, 99% of hydrochloric acid (HCl) aerosol of 2 microns or greater, 99% of HCl vapor, and 99% of SOx emissions. The LEV system was designed in accordance with the American Conference of Governmental Industrial Hygienists (ACGH) guidelines.

3. LEV and APC Systems and Regulatory Reporting (Massachusetts)

M&A assisted a manufacturer of vibration and motion isolators that uses VOC-based adhesives in preparation of metal parts for bonding to molded rubber isolators, in improvements to personal exposure monitoring, materials tracking, emissions calculations, air source registration, design, and permitting for LEV and APC systems to control volatile organic compounds. This project has included assisting with the design of manufacturing equipment, including the retrofit of a novel spray-tumble painting machine and design of new paint booths equipped with automatic drying system.
